  • Vista (Score:5, Insightful)

    by RAMMS+EIN ( 578166 ) on Sunday December 31, 2006 @11:06AM (#17416036) Homepage Journal
    I think the big thing to happen to security in 2007 is Windows Vista. With increasing adoption, we will really get to see whether all the rewrites, new features, and bugfixes dramatically improve security. Holes will be found and plugged. Other operating systems will copy the good ideas and avoid the bad ones. Whenever pre-Vista Windows versions are broken into, people will say "It's your own fault; you should just have upgraded to Vista".

    Other than that, I think existing trends will continue. More development will be shifted from unsafe languages like C and C++ to Java, the .NET languages, and the popular languages from the open source community. Exploits will continue to shift from buffer overflows and integer overruns to logic errors and injection vulnerabilities. More attacks will target web browsers. With increasing adoption of Unix-like OSes, perhaps we will see some exploits for these run wild, too.

  • At least on the East Coast a DDOS attack on the stock market's internet connection isn't going to make much of a difference. Both market data and B2B order flow typically go across the SFTI network which was created after 9/11 and has no public access.     • by juct ( 549812 )
      Of course some of the stuff is far fetched -- that's where the fun is ...

      But while I agree that the number of zombies may decline, I don't think the number of attacks will do so. This only means, that an infected PC is "worth" more and the bad guys will put more effort into staying unnoticed and keeping control. We already see that trend in the latest botnet clients like Spamthru: decentralized control infrastructure is beeing built, rootkits are used, rivals are removed and so on ...
